Lorrainville to Saint-Hyacinthe

Updated: 31 May 2026

Traveling from Lorrainville to Saint-Hyacinthe covers approximately 720 kilometers. The route primarily follows Route 117 through the Laurentians before merging onto Highway 15 and Highway 20. This journey takes you from the Témiscamingue region into the agricultural heartland of the Montérégie. Driving is the most efficient way to complete this trip. Expect a travel time of approximately 8.5 hours.

Total Distance: Driving distance is 720 km; straight-line air distance is 490 km.

Travel Tips
  • Traffic
    Avoid the Montreal metropolitan area during morning and evening rush hours.
  • Navigation
    Use a GPS to navigate the complex highway interchanges in the Greater Montreal area.
  • Rest Stops
    Stop in Saint-Jérôme for a break before entering the busy Montreal traffic.
  • Fuel
    Ensure your vehicle is serviced before the long drive through the La Vérendrye reserve.
  • Weather
    Check for snow squalls in the Laurentians during late autumn.
Safety Tips
  • Road Conditions
    Check Quebec 511 for construction updates on Highway 20.
  • Wildlife
    Watch for animals crossing the road in the northern sections of the route.
  • Emergency Kit
    Carry a winter emergency kit including blankets and a shovel.
  • Visibility
    Use headlights at all times when driving through the forested sections of the route.
